Hello, I am excited to introduce myself as the new President of the Western Australia AVA Division. Whilst I have been on the committee and a representative for the Northern branch for a number of years now, this is definitely a big step for me.
I was born and raised in Dampier in the Pilbara region, a place that deeply influenced my passion for animals of all species and drove my desire to work in the veterinary field. After taking the long road (with a few detours on the way) I graduated from James Cook University in 2012 and have since worked in various states and different areas of veterinary science, gaining a wide range of experiences and exposure to different states regulations and governing bodies.
In July 2025, I took an important step in my journey by starting my own business, Pilbara Vet Care, a mobile veterinary service providing access to veterinary care throughout the Pilbara region, from dogs and cats, to horses and cows, right through to marine mammals and land reptiles.
I’m passionate about our industry and truly believe in the power of advocating for our profession and representing the diverse voices within it. My goal as President is to work alongside an amazing team of vets to support the advocacy and evolution of the WA veterinary family and ensure that we continue to shape our profession for the better.
One of my recent experiences that I’m particularly proud of was providing the emergency veterinary response in Exmouth following Cyclone Narelle. It was both extremely challenging and rewarding, but that’s a story for another time!
I’m truly excited about the future and look forward to working with all of you to make a positive impact in the veterinary community here in Western Australia. Let’s collaborate to ensure our profession continues to thrive!
